Development Description: Construction of a solar farm (up to 40MW export capacity) with ancillary infrastructure and cabling, DNO substation, customer substation and construction of new and altered vehicular accesses.
Grove Farm Solar - Public Inquiry
Following an appeal by Greenswitch Capital against the decision by Babergh District Council to refuse the application, a public inquiry will be held.
The inquiry will be held at Wherstead Park, The St, Wherstead, Ipswich IP9 2BJ from 10:00am on Tuesday 20 January 2026.
It will continue on 21 –22 January 2026 and 27 – 28 January 2026 with 29 January 2026 in reserve.

N.B. Since the Council issued its decision notice, the Bentley Conservation Area has been designated. This site falls within the new Conservation Area boundary.
Inquiries are open to members of the public, and although you do not have a legal right to speak, the Inspector will normally allow you to do so. Local people are encouraged to take part in the inquiry process as local knowledge and opinion can often be a valuable addition to the more formal evidence given. Most people prefer to read out a brief statement giving their views.
If you want to speak at the inquiry, it is important that you are there on 20th January because this is when the Inspector will tell everyone about the timetable.
